Asset Depletion Loans Florida

Asset-Based Mortgages in Florida

You built the savings. An asset depletion loan lets that money qualify you, even if your paycheck does not. The lender turns your balances into a monthly income figure on paper.

Standard loans need a job and tax returns. Plenty of Florida buyers have neither in the form lenders expect, yet they hold serious wealth. Asset depletion solves that mismatch.

Who uses it? Retirees living on investments, business owners between ventures, and high-net-worth buyers whose income is low on paper but whose accounts tell the real story.

Which Accounts Count
Checking & savings100% usually
Brokerage / investmentOften discounted
Retirement (59ยฝ+)Often discounted
Home equityDoes not count
Discount factors vary by lender and account type.
Qualifying Example โ€” Illustration
Eligible assets$1,200,000
Divided over120 months
Qualifying income~$10,000/mo
Min down payment20โ€“30%
Min FICO620+
Job income neededNone
Illustration only โ€” not a rate quote. Formula and term vary by lender.
Rates & Costs

What Asset Depletion Loans Cost

Asset depletion loans sit in the non-QM family, so they price a bit above a standard conventional loan. Your rate improves with a larger down payment, strong credit, and a healthy cushion of assets beyond what the loan requires.

Reserves Help
Assets well above the minimum show strength and can sharpen your rate.
Down Payment
Larger down payments lower risk and the rate that comes with it.
Credit Profile
A clean history at 700-plus earns the best pricing on these loans.

How to Qualify

How Asset-Based Buyers Get Approved

1. Total your assets
We add up eligible checking, savings, brokerage, and retirement balances.
2. Apply the formula
The lender divides your assets over a set term to create a monthly qualifying income.
3. Check the ratios
That figure runs through the debt-to-income test like any other income source.
4. Close on your wealth
No job or tax-return income needed โ€” qualify on the accounts you already hold.
Florida Notes

Asset-Based Buyers in Florida

Florida is a retirement magnet, and many newcomers arrive with strong portfolios and modest reported income. Asset depletion was practically built for that buyer. It turns a lifetime of saving into real buying power for a home in The Villages, Naples, Sarasota, or the coast.

Snowbirds buying a second home benefit too. When you split time between states and live off investments, an asset-based mortgage often approves the purchase that a paycheck-driven loan would decline.

Asset Depletion FAQ

Asset Depletion Loan Questions, Answered

What is an asset depletion loan?
An asset depletion loan lets you qualify using your liquid assets instead of a paycheck. The lender converts your savings, investment, and retirement accounts into a monthly income figure by spreading the balance over a set number of months. Who qualifies for an asset-based mortgage in Florida?
Retirees, near-retirees, and high-net-worth buyers are the usual fit. If you have a large nest egg but no W-2 or your tax returns understate what you can really afford, an asset-based mortgage may approve you when a standard loan will not. Florida's many retirees and snowbirds use this path often.
How is the qualifying income calculated?
Lenders take your eligible liquid assets, sometimes apply a discount to investment and retirement balances, then divide by a fixed term such as 84 or 120 months. The result is treated as monthly income for the debt-to-income calculation. You are not required to withdraw or spend the money.
Which assets count toward an asset depletion loan?
Checking, savings, money market, brokerage accounts, and most retirement funds typically count. Retirement accounts are often discounted and may be limited if you are under 59 and a half. Home equity and business operating accounts usually do not count. We review your statements to estimate the qualifying figure.
What credit score and down payment do I need?
Most asset depletion programs want a 620 or higher score and 20 to 30 percent down, though strong reserves can help. Because the loan leans on your assets, lenders look for a clean credit history alongside the account balances. We match your profile to the lender with the friendliest terms.
Can I use an asset depletion loan for a second home in Florida?
Yes. Asset-based qualifying works for primary homes, second homes, and in some cases investment properties. Snowbirds buying a Florida second home frequently use it because their retirement assets qualify them even when their reported income is modest.
